Форум программистов, компьютерный форум, киберфорум
Наши страницы

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
Галочка Громова
1 / 1 / 0
Регистрация: 10.02.2010
Сообщений: 36
#1

STL - C++

13.05.2010, 01:13. Просмотров 374. Ответов 0
Метки нет (Все метки)

привет.спасибо одному новичку, но я ничего не смогла объяснить , когда ПРЕПОД меня начал спрашивать(((
что надо исправить во второй части программы чтобы выполнилось условие задачи!!!!

//Дан текст. Вывести на экран в алфавитном порядке согласные буквы,
//которые входят в каждое нечетное слово и не входят ни в одно четное слово; гласные
//буквы, входящие только в одно слово.

C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
#include <set>
#include <iostream>
#include <cstdlib>
#include <string>
#include <functional>
#include <numeric>
#include <algorithm>
using namespace std;
 
 
int main(int argc, char* argv[])
{
    multiset<char> st;
    int cnt;
    char text[101];
    char alv2[] = "b c d f g h k l m n p q r s v t w x z";
    char alv1[] = "a e i o u y";
    cout << "Enter text:\n";
    cin.getline(text,100);
    for(int i=0;i<strlen(text);i++){
        st.insert(text[i]);
    }
    cout << "What do you do?\n";
    cout << "1. glasnue bykvu, kotorue vhodyat tol'ko v odno clovo.\n";
    cout << "2. soGlacnue bykvu, которые входят в каждое нечетное слово и не входят ни в одно четное слово.\n:";
    cin >> cnt;
    cout << endl;
    if(cnt == 1){
        for(int i=0;i<strlen(alv1);i++){
        if(alv1[i] == ' ') continue;
            else if(alv1[i] != ' '){
                cnt = st.count(alv1[i]);
                if(cnt == 0){
                    cout << alv1[i] << " ";
                }
            }
        }
        cout << endl;
    }
    if(cnt == 2){
        for(int i=0;i<strlen(alv2);i++){
        if(alv2[i] == ' ') continue;
            else if(alv2[i] != ' '){
                cnt = st.count(alv2[i]);
                if (cnt  == 0 ){
                    cout << alv2[i] << " ";
                }
            }
        }
        cout << endl;
    }
    return 0;
}
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
13.05.2010, 01:13
Здравствуйте! Я подобрал для вас темы с ответами на вопрос STL (C++):

STL - C++
Добрый вечер всем кто открыл эту вкладку! Надо реализовать кольцевой упорядоченный двозвязний список на STL + некоторые функции работы с...

STL - C++
Всем привет :) Задача следующая - Нужно считать из файла строки, запихнуть их в стек и вывести на экран, чтобы перед ними был номер...

STL в С++ - C++
Нужна помощь! Дана строка, состоящая из русских слов, разделенных пробелами (одним или несколькими). Определить количество слов, которые...

STL - C++
std::vector&lt;char*&gt; files; Объясните пожалуйста как правильно заполнять такой вектор

STL - C++
где можно посмотреть исходный код STL??

STL - C++
помогите сделать ввод ФИО и возраста через STL .Вот часть моего кода#include &lt;string&gt; #include &lt;vector&gt; #include &lt;algorithm&gt; #include...

0
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
13.05.2010, 01:13
Привет! Вот еще темы с ответами:

STL - C++
Задача 2. Во входном файле in.txt расположена таблица, в каждой строке которой хранится &quot;владелец&quot;, &quot;домашнее животное&quot;, &quot;кличка&quot;....

STL - C++
Блин нарорд... я затупил по жоскому.... у меня std::vector, пытаюсь добавить элемент на n-e место: using namecpace std; ...

STL - C++
где можно почитать про STL очень подробно что бы исходные коды тоже были, какие структуры данных используются в реализации и тд тд тд ...

STL. - C++
Всем доброго времени суток. У меня имеется два вопроса. 1) У нас имется квадратная матрица. И чтобы найти в строках, к примеру,...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
1
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ru